Job Title: System Integration Engineer

Location: Coventry

Driving the future of automotive. We’re Lear For You.

Company Overview

Position overview:

The Systems Integration Engineer will play a pivotal role within Lear’s regional Innovation Hub, operating under the EU & Africa Advanced Manufacturing and Engineering team. This position offers a unique opportunity to work at the intersection of manufacturing, digitalisation, and technology deployment, collaborating closely with Subject Matter Experts across Manufacturing, Logistics, Quality, and IT.

The ideal candidate will have a strong background in systems engineering, automation, and digital integration, with a passion for connecting disparate technologies into cohesive, scalable solutions. The Systems Integration Engineer is responsible for designing, developing, and implementing integrated systems that enhance operational efficiency, data visibility, and process control across Lear’s regional operations.

This is a hands-on, solution-focused role ideal for someone who thrives in dynamic environments, enjoys solving complex technical challenges, and is driven by the impact of real-world engineering applications. From concept to deployment, the engineer will lead integration efforts for Industry 4.0 technologies, including IoT, MES, ERP interfaces, and smart automation systems

Key Responsibilities:

System Integration Design:

1. Architect and implement integration solutions between diverse technologies (e.g., IoT devices, cloud platforms, AI models, control systems).
2. Understand complex systems across Hardware, Software and process layers.
3. Define and manage data flows, APIs, and communication protocols.

Integration & Interoperability:

4. Proficiency in integrating diverse technologies (e.g., PLCs, IoT devices, MES, ERP systems).
5. Knowledge of communication protocols (OPC UA, MQTT, REST APIs).

Software & Automation

6. Programming/scripting skills (Python, C++, Java, or similar).
7. Familiarity with automation platforms (Siemens, Rockwell, Beckhoff) and industrial software (Ignition, Kepware, TwinCAT).
8. Experience with edge computing and cloud integration (Azure, AWS, etc.).

Middleware and API Development:

9. Develop and maintain middleware components and APIs to enable modular system design.
10. Ensure secure and efficient data exchange between components.

Technical Coordination:

11. Collaborate with software developers, hardware engineers, and data scientists to align interfaces and system requirements.
12. Troubleshoot integration issues and ensure system compatibility.
13. Evaluate emerging control technologies (edge computing, AI-based control, etc.)
14. Support feasibility studies and POC development
15. Create integration maps, interface specifications, and technical documentation

Collaboration and Communication:

16. Work closely with teams in Manufacturing, Logistics, Quality, and IT to understand operational needs and translate them into technical solutions.
17. Build and manage relationships with external partners, including universities, research institutions, and suppliers, to foster collaboration and access new technologies or knowledge
